  • Special Effects Makeup Artist Howard Berger ("The Chronicles of Narnia") reveals how he creates movie monsters.
    In this movie makeup tutorial, he demonstrates the process he uses to create movie makeup that brings characters to life on the big screen.
    Berger has worked on such films as "The Chronicles of Narnia: The Lion, the Witch and the Wardrobe," "Inglourious Basterds," and "The Green Mile" among others.
